What is the TCF Test?
The TCF is a main French language proficiency test developed to assess the linguistic skills of non-native speakers. It evaluates 4 vital proficiencies: listening, checking out, speaking, and composing. The test is managed by the French Ministry of Education and is recognized by various instructional organizations, businesses, and government entities worldwide.

Before signing up, it is crucial to comprehend the structure of the TCF. The test includes the following areas:
SectionDurationPointsDescriptionListening25 minutes100Assessing understanding of spoken FrenchChecking out40 minutes100Evaluating understanding of composed textsComposing60 minutes100Testing written expression and grammarSpeaking12 minutes100Determining oral proficiency and fluency
The overall score ranges from 100 to 699, lining up with the Common European Framework of Reference for Languages (CEFR).

TCF scores do not have an official expiration date, however many institutions recommend sending scores from the last two years.
How long does the TCF test take?
The whole TCF test lasts around 2 to 3 hours, depending on the version and the specific components examined.
Can I retake the TCF test?
Yes, prospects can retake the TCF test as frequently as they like to enhance their scores. It is a good idea to wait a minimum of a couple of months to enable sufficient preparation.
Exists a minimum score needed to pass the TCF?
There is no universal passing score for the TCF. Each organization or employer sets its own requirements based on their needs.
Can I register for the TCF test online?
Yes, a lot of test centers use an online registration choice. However, prospects should make sure that their registration is verified through follow-up interaction from the center.
